I want to take a moment to talk about something every man should have in his closet: a good wool sweater. I get a lot of men telling me they don't like wool because it's itchy. I used to feel the same way. But as I discovered recently, I was wearing wool the wrong way. T-shirts (even long sleeve ones) don't belong under a wool sweater. Those in the know wear a long sleeve button-front Oxford shirt underneath, preferably a cotton one, on the thick side. I prefer a button-down collar that stays inside (as shown in this pic), but a spread collar can work too. It doesn't have to match the sweater, in fact, sometimes it's better if it doesn't. The sweater/shirt combo is a great way to showcase your personal style, and it's very warm, while looking casual-yet-classy. This was a total game changer for me. It's not a necessity to get a 100% wool sweater. I prefer one like this LL Bean Snowflake sweater, that has a 25% nylon blend to give it a little stretch and breathability. Vintage wool is thicker and higher quality than modern wool, so thrift store finds are always great. For a springy, stretchy feel, try Merino wool. I like Merino cardigans and full-zip sweaters. And then of course there's Cashmere. It doesn't last as long as traditional wool, and costs a lot more, but DAMN it feels good, and is VERY warm. Unlike cotton or fleece sweaters which eventually lose their shape and end up looking awful after a season or two, wool lasts forever (as long as you don't wash it in the washing machine). Because wool has natural antibacterial properties, you really only need to have a sweater dry cleaned if you get something on it. I tumble mine in the dryer with a dryer sheet once a season to keep them smelling fresh. Wool is also a renewable resource, as many farms use the same sheep year after year to produce their wool. Check out American heritage companies like Woolrich, Johnson Woolen Mills, or my favorite, LL Bean. One more cool fact about wool: hunters prefer it because it keeps you warm even when it's wet!
